2026年1月1日, 学术期刊Angewandte Chemie International Edition在线刊登了北京大学药学院天然药物及仿生药物全国重点实验室王晶团队最新研究成果“Dual-Proximity Labeling Strategy Identifies TrxR1 as a Cuproprotein that Regulates Apoptosis via Caspase-3 S-Nitrosylation”(双邻近标记策略鉴定TrxR1是一种铜蛋白, 它通过Caspase-3 S-亚硝基化调控细胞凋亡)。
